Description

Company Overview Lawson Drayage is the oldest and most respected machinery-moving and high-tech handling company in the Greater Bay Area, Northern California, and Western Nevada. Family owned and operated for over 100 years, we pride ourselves on quality workmanship and strong customer relationships. We offer competitive wages, excellent benefits (medical, dental, vision), generous PTO (vacation, sick, holiday pay), and a Profit-Sharing Plan.


Position Summary

We’re seeking an experienced Fleet Mechanic with strong diesel/heavy-equipment experience to maintain and repair our truck and forklift fleet. The ideal candidate is self-motivated, eager to learn in a fast-paced environment, and provides reliable, high-quality work using their own tools.

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form maintenance and repairs on company vehicles including Class 1–9 trucks/trailers and Class IV & V forklifts.
  • Diagnose and repair diesel engines, air brake systems, hydraulic systems, electrical systems, fuel and emission systems, steering, suspension, transmissions, and air conditioning.
  • Conduct preventive maintenance, oil changes, greasing, and thorough inspections.
  • Perform 90-day BIT inspections on trucks and trailers and complete required paperwork.
  • Use industry diagnostic tools and software to identify and resolve complex mechanical and electrical issues.
  • Perform quality repairs to OEM specifications and maintain accurate maintenance/repair records.
  • Maintain a safe, organized work area and follow company safety procedures.
  • Attend paid training as required.

Qualifications

  • Proven fleet or heavy diesel mechanic experience (truck and forklift experience preferred).
  • Strong diagnostic skills across diesel engines, air brakes, hydraulics, and electrical systems.
  • Ability to perform preventive maintenance and both minor and major repairs.
  • Familiarity with industry diagnostic tools/software.
  • Valid driver’s license.
  • Good computer skills and effective oral/written communication.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team; able to perform under pressure.
  • Must have own tools and willingness to attend training
  • Pay commensurate with experience.
  • Offer contingent on successful pre-employment background check, physical, and drug test.
